This was a pub between 1852 and 1907 and thereafter a shop. It abutted Winchelsea House of the Swan Estate shown on the right. I remember it, 1960s, as a two storey building. I cannot answer my own query :- 2 storeys / abutting / window above mural. The pub protruded a little way past the bollard, as in the 1960s the road was very narrow. The shop disappeared in the early 1970s. Building in the centre is Rye House and in the background is the Adams Garden Estate.
